As long as there is cinema, LE CERCLE will be there. It is the only television program of critical debates 100% devoted to cinema. Each week, it offers fiery, joyful and non-condescending jousts on the films on the bill; and invites with "Le questionnaire du CERCLE" directors to come and share their passion for cinema.

Le Cercle helped democratize film criticism in France, making intellectual debate feel like entertainment rather than homework.
The show's longevity proves audiences crave genuine disagreement over consensus — something algorithm-driven platforms still haven't cracked.
